Ellington’s Restaurant on the fourth floor of the Fairlane Hotel pops up as the exclusive, Dorsia, this Halloween in celebration of the film American Psycho’s twentieth anniversary.

Fairlane Hotel is known for excellent service holding the position as Trip Advisor’s #1 Hotel in Nashville for over two consecutive years. The former bank building brings a buttoned-up, classic mid-century persona to 4th Avenue’s Boutique Row and downtown Nashville’s financial district.

2019 11 02 NMP Fairlane 00291

After much success hosting the immersive theater portrayal of Patrick Bateman’s Penthouse last Halloween, the Fairlane plans to take another stab at it, but this time, in Ellington’s Restaurant. Chef Kristin Beringson will feature a 5 course Chef’s Tasting Menu with a Dorsia twist. the cost is $65 per person for the Chef’s Tasting.There is an optional Wine & Cocktail Pairing for $35 per person.

Guests are encouraged to dress in high 80’s fashion and enjoy craft cocktails, music, and decor including a suspended chainsaw all inspired by American Psycho. If lucky enough to get a reservation, guests might even catch a glimpse of Patrick Batemen himself. Actors will be featured from 6 – 9 PM, nightly.
